Best Western Premier Dover Marina Hotel & Spa, Dover
About the Hotel
Best Western Premier Dover Marina Hotel & Spa is a historic hotel situated on the picturesque seafront of Dover, providing striking views of the English Channel and Dover Castle. It features elegantly restored interiors within a 19th-century building, blending modern amenities with Victorian charm. The hotel's amenities include two restaurants by Marco Pierre White, a full-service spa, and exceptional leisure facilities, making it a prominent destination for both leisure travelers and business events.
Location
Conveniently located 15 minutes' walk from Dover Priory and near ferry terminals, the hotel serves as a gateway to continental travel. The nearby White Cliffs of Dover provide scenic walking trails, while local attractions such as Dover Castle and Canterbury Cathedral are easily accessible. Parking facilities are available within walking distance of the hotel.
Rooms
The hotel boasts 122 luxurious bedrooms, catering to various preferences, including doubles, family rooms, and suites. Sea view rooms offer stunning vistas across the English Channel and towards France on clear days. For families, accommodations feature multiple beds, ensuring ample space for relaxation and comfort. Each room is equipped with modern amenities, air conditioning, and thoughtful furnishings.
Eat & Drink
Dining at the hotel is highlighted by Marco Pierre White's two restaurants, offering a diverse menu with a focus on steak, fresh fish, and vegetarian dishes. Guests can experience the traditional Afternoon Tea with a modern twist, featuring finger sandwiches, scones, and homemade pastries. The Waterfront Bar & Lounge provides a casual setting for enjoying drinks or light bites while overlooking the sea.
Leisure & Business
The Waterfront Spa & Health Club offers a comprehensive range of treatments and wellness facilities, including a gym, sauna, and steam room. Business services are also available, with versatile event spaces accommodating various functions. Guests can participate in organized activities, unwind with spa treatments, or enjoy evening entertainment such as live jazz events.
